HEICO Corporation
HEICO Corporation is a successful and growing technology-driven aerospace, industrial, defense and electronics company. For more than 60 years, HEICO has thrived by providing customers with innovative and cost-saving products and services.
HEICO's products are found on large commercial aircraft, regional, business and military aircraft, as well as on a large variety of industrial turbines, targeting systems, missiles and electro-optical devices.
HEICO Corporation is a New York Stock Exchange listed company (NYSE: HEI and HEI.A) and has also been ranked as one of the 100 "World's Most Innovative Growth Companies", 100 "Best Small Companies" and 200 "Hot Shot Stocks" by Forbes over the past decade. With headquarters in Hollywood, Florida, and multiple locations around the world - HEICO provides over 1 million square feet of design, manufacturing, repair, overhaul, distribution, sales and support capabilities.
HEICO Corporation operates in two segments, the Flight Support group and the Electronic Technologies group. The Flight Support group designs, engineers, manufactures, repairs, distributes and overhauls FAA-approved parts that extend over the entire aircraft, from the engines all the way to hydraulic, pneumatic, electromechanical, avionic, structures, wheels and brakes and even interiors.
The Electronic Technologies group produces electrical and electro-optical systems and components serving niche segments of the aerospace, defense, communications, and computer industries. The Electronic Technologies group is a worldwide leader in the design, manufacture and sale of electrically and electro-optical engineered products used in the aerospace, defense, space, and electronics industries.
